Frøya Idrettslag is a Norwegian sports club based in Laksevåg, Bergen. Founded in 1928, it has sections for association football and basketball.[3] The club's colours are orange and yellow.[4]

Football
The football section, Frøya Fotball, played in the Norwegian Third Division in 2001, 2004–2008 and 2014.[1] It plays its home matches at Frøya Idrettspark.[4] In 2021, they won promotion back to the Third Division.[5]
